- [ ] Key ceremony step 7: Date localization check. Before sealing the Ravelin signing keys, confirm all ceremony logs render dates in ISO 8601, not locale-dependent formats. Last quarter the Oslo witness copy showed day/month swapped against the Chicago copy and reconciliation took two days. Verify both observer terminals are pinned to UTC. Flag mismatches before signatures, not after — nothing gets re-sealed once the quorum disperses. Log the check in the sync notes. The passphrase to unlock the ceremony log archive is:

unlock words, hahip-baduf: holwyn-istath-julvan

Subject: Quickstore 4.2 — bloom filter now fronts the KV layer

Plugin authors: starting with this release, Quickstore places a bloom filter ahead of the key-value store. Negative lookups return faster; false positives fall through safely. No API changes are required on your side. Verify your plugin against the staging build referenced below.

session token of fahif-tadup = htk3_9c7

- [ ] Verify payroll export v4 format before merge. Stipendia's column order changed: deductions now precede gross, and the currency field is ISO-coded instead of symbols. Confirm the golden-file tests were regenerated, not hand-edited. Check that the legacy v3 endpoint still emits the old layout — downstream at Harlowe Benefits hasn't migrated. Reject if the schema version header is missing. The staging export used for sign-off was produced by the build referenced by the token below.

trace token, fafog-kageg: htk4_98e6

## Service Accounts — Schema Migrations (Zero Downtime)

Migrations on Larkfield run via the `mig-runner` service account. Rules: expand-then-contract only. Add nullable columns first, backfill via the Drossel queue, then flip reads, then drop old columns in a later release. Never lock `catalog_items` during business hours. Dual-write windows must stay under 48h. The runner authenticates against the Pellinor migration API; contractors don't get personal credentials. Use the shared runner key below for staging only.

gateway credential: kto23_dolYgAScEh2TaPOlStqOl98